Jungle Zipline Canopy Tour with the 'Zuperman' Line

Roatan's hilly rainforest is built for ziplining, and South Shore Adventures strings lines and suspension bridges across its eco park with jungle-and-ocean views the whole way. The signature 'Zuperman' line flies you face-down and superman-style toward the sea. It's the classic high-adrenaline Roatan adventure and, at this price, one of the best-value marquee excursions on the island.

What to expect

You'll be transported into Roatan's hilly rainforest eco park, where you'll launch across a series of ziplines and suspension bridges strung between the canopy with jungle and ocean views opening up beneath you the entire way. The signature "Zuperman" line is the crescendo—a face-down, superman-style flight that propels you toward the sea in a pure adrenaline rush. Between lines, you'll pause at platforms to catch your breath and take in the landscape, building momentum toward that final, unforgettable dive. The whole experience is designed as a high-octane jungle flight, with the rhythm moving from anticipation to action to that iconic moment most people come for.

Who to call — book direct
South Shore Adventures (South Shore Zipline)
$40-$45pp for the Zipline Canopy Tour (Zuperman line same price). Zip-and-Zuper combo $75-$80pp; All-Adventures combo (adds Eco-Walk) $85-$90pp. Add-ons for sloth encounters, beach break and private transport available. Book direct at southshorezipline.com/shop.

Beats the ship · vs the cruise line

Direct wins. Carnival's jungle zipline is $65pp and ship zipline + sloth + beach combos hit $89-$99pp. The core zipline direct is $40-$45pp -- about $20-$25pp less for the same flying lines. If you want the wildlife and beach stops the ship bundles, build them as direct add-ons and you'll still come out ahead, just confirm port pickup and your sail-back time.

Good to know

Book directly through southshorezipline.com/shop at $40–$45pp to save $20–$25 compared to the ship's $65pp option; confirm port pickup from the pier and your sail-back time before booking. Plan for a 6–8 hour window with travel time factored in—bring water, sunscreen, and secure shoes; the operator provides harnesses and safety gear. If you want to add sloth encounters or a beach break, book them as direct add-ons rather than bundled through the ship to maximize savings. Verify transportation logistics (especially your return window to the pier) directly with South Shore Adventures when you book.
